mirror of
https://github.com/veracrypt/VeraCrypt.git
synced 2025-11-11 19:08:26 -06:00
Static Code Analysis: clarify macros definition and use.
This commit is contained in:
@@ -108,7 +108,7 @@ extern "C"
|
|||||||
( ( unsigned __int32 ) memPtr[ -2 ] << 8 ) | ( unsigned __int32 ) memPtr[ -1 ] )
|
( ( unsigned __int32 ) memPtr[ -2 ] << 8 ) | ( unsigned __int32 ) memPtr[ -1 ] )
|
||||||
|
|
||||||
#define mgetWord(memPtr) \
|
#define mgetWord(memPtr) \
|
||||||
( memPtr += 2, ( unsigned short ) memPtr[ -2 ] << 8 ) | ( ( unsigned short ) memPtr[ -1 ] )
|
( memPtr += 2, ((( unsigned short ) memPtr[ -2 ] << 8 ) | ( ( unsigned short ) memPtr[ -1 ] )) )
|
||||||
|
|
||||||
#define mgetByte(memPtr) \
|
#define mgetByte(memPtr) \
|
||||||
( ( unsigned char ) *memPtr++ )
|
( ( unsigned char ) *memPtr++ )
|
||||||
|
|||||||
@@ -521,10 +521,10 @@ AES_RETURN aes_decrypt_key256(const unsigned char *key, aes_decrypt_ctx cx[1])
|
|||||||
#endif
|
#endif
|
||||||
}
|
}
|
||||||
#else
|
#else
|
||||||
cx->ks[v(56,(4))] = ff(ss[4] = word_in(key, 4));
|
ss[4] = word_in(key, 4); cx->ks[v(56,(4))] = ff(ss[4]);
|
||||||
cx->ks[v(56,(5))] = ff(ss[5] = word_in(key, 5));
|
ss[5] = word_in(key, 5); cx->ks[v(56,(5))] = ff(ss[5]);
|
||||||
cx->ks[v(56,(6))] = ff(ss[6] = word_in(key, 6));
|
ss[6] = word_in(key, 6); cx->ks[v(56,(6))] = ff(ss[6]);
|
||||||
cx->ks[v(56,(7))] = ff(ss[7] = word_in(key, 7));
|
ss[7] = word_in(key, 7); cx->ks[v(56,(7))] = ff(ss[7]);
|
||||||
kdf8(cx->ks, 0); kd8(cx->ks, 1);
|
kdf8(cx->ks, 0); kd8(cx->ks, 1);
|
||||||
kd8(cx->ks, 2); kd8(cx->ks, 3);
|
kd8(cx->ks, 2); kd8(cx->ks, 3);
|
||||||
kd8(cx->ks, 4); kd8(cx->ks, 5);
|
kd8(cx->ks, 4); kd8(cx->ks, 5);
|
||||||
|
|||||||
Reference in New Issue
Block a user